What is a GCC engineer?

GCC Engineers are professionals who specialize in working with the GNU Compiler Collection (GCC), a widely used open-source compiler system that supports various programming languages like C, C++, and Fortran. Their responsibilities often include developing, maintaining, and optimizing compiler code, troubleshooting compilation issues, and ensuring compatibility across different platforms. GCC Engineers play a crucial role in enabling software to run efficiently and reliably by improving the performance and capabilities of the compiler. They may also collaborate with open-source communities to contribute patches and new features to the GCC project.

What are the typical collaboration points between a GCC engineer and other development teams within a large software project?

GCC Engineers frequently interact with software developers, QA engineers, and systems architects to ensure that the compiler toolchain operates efficiently and meets project requirements. They may assist in diagnosing build issues, optimizing code for specific hardware, or integrating new language features. Effective communication is essential, as GCC Engineers often explain complex compiler behaviors or propose changes to build processes. This collaborative environment helps maintain code quality and accelerates development cycles.
